Betwara
Betwara is a village located in Kalyanpur subdivision of Samastipur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Kalyanpur (tehsildar office) and 18km away from district headquarter Samastipur. As per 2009 stats, Simaria Bhindi is the gram panchayat of Betwara village.

About Betwara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Betwara is 236227. The village spans a total geographical area of 116 hectares. Samastipur is nearest town to Betwara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Betwara
According to the 2011 Census, Betwara has a total population of about 1,205, with approximately 610 males and 595 females. The sex ratio is around 975 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 302 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,172 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 29.63%, with male literacy at about 35.41% and female literacy near 23.70%. There are around 219 households in the village. Connectivity of Betwara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Betwara. As per the 2011 stats, Betwara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
